Request for proposals for Media Virtual Production Trainers. Introduction: Within the framework of the "Quality Urban Development and Sustainable Interventions Rehabilitation for Revitalization (QUDSI-R4R)" project, funded by the European Union and managed by the United Nations Human Settlements Program (UN-Habitat) in the Regional Office of Arab States, partly implemented by Al-Quds University, we are pleased to announce a Request for Proposals for trainers specializing in Media Virtual Production. The training will be conducted at Dar Al Consul Community Center in the Old City of Jerusalem, with a few online sessions. Objective This training program aims to equip participants with practical skills in virtual media production by integrating real-time virtual environments with traditional filmmaking and broadcasting techniques. Designed for digital content creators, filmmakers, media producers, and digital artists, this program will focus on immersive storytelling, virtual set creation, live compositing, and real-time visual effects. Training Areas Introduction to Virtual Production: Understanding fundamental principles, initial setup, and working with game engines like Unreal Engine. Virtual Set Design: Building and customizing 3D environments, integrating assets using Unreal Engine and Quixel Megascans. Real-Time Rendering: Optimizing performance, lighting, and shading in virtual environments. Live Compositing and Visual Effects: Integrating live footage with virtual backgrounds, virtual cinematography using Unreal Engine and OBS Studio. Immersive Storytelling: Developing interactive story concepts, immersive content scripting, and audience engagement strategies. Final Project and Presentation: Producing a complete virtual media project and presenting it for peer review. Scope of Work Selected trainers will be responsible for: · Designing and delivering a 35-hour training curriculum covering the specified areas. · Implementing a project-based and hands-on learning approach. · Providing real-world applications for acquired skills. · Assessing participants progress and providing constructive feedback. Deliverables · A detailed training plan and structured curriculum. · Training materials and resource guides for participants. · A structured schedule of training sessions. · Individual and group-based trainee projects. · A comprehensive final report summarizing training outcomes. Trainer Qualifications · Existing access to the Old City of Jerusalem. · Proven experience in virtual media production and real-time visual effects. · Strong background in tools such as Unreal Engine, Quixel Megascans, OBS Studio. · Excellent communication and instructional skills. · Experience in developing interactive, project-based training programs. · Familiarity with the QUDSI-R4R project goals and the Dar Al Consul Community Center mission.
